SolidWorks 2012 Service Pack 5.0 (SP5.0) represents the final evolutionary peak of the 2012 release cycle, a version that remains a significant touchstone in the history of computer-aided design (CAD) software. As the definitive "integrated" ISO release for that year, it bundled all previous updates and language support into a single, comprehensive installation package. This version is particularly notable for being the final release of SolidWorks to support the Windows XP operating system, marking the end of an era for legacy computing in engineering environments.

The most compelling argument for preserving this specific ISO is its legendary stability. By 2012, SolidWorks had fully transitioned to the Parasolid kernel (Siemens) and had refined its memory management for Windows 7 64-bit systems. Unlike modern CAD packages that update every six weeks, disrupting workflows and breaking downstream integrations, SP5.0 was the "set it and forget it" deployment. For manufacturing shops operating legacy CNC machines or using specific PDM (Product Data Management) connectors, this ISO was the holy grail. It allowed engineers to focus on design fidelity rather than software management .
